Kritika Kamra Is All Set to Marry Gaurav Kapoor in an Intimate Mumbai Wedding In March, Deets Inside

Wedding bells are set to ring for popular TV actress Kritika Kamra, who is reportedly tying the knot with her boyfriend, sports commentator Gaurav Kapoor, in March 2026. The couple is said to be planning a simple and elegant ceremony in Mumbai, choosing intimacy over extravagance. According to sources close to the couple, Kritika and Gaurav have opted for a minimalistic and modern wedding instead of a lavish destination affair.

Kritika Kamra And Gaurav Kapoor To Marry Soon

The ceremony will reportedly take place in Mumbai next month, with only close friends and family members in attendance. A source revealed, “Kritika and Gaurav both want to avoid grand celebrations. They have planned a modern, minimal, and intimate wedding that reflects their personalities and values.” Both families are said to be almost done with the preparations, ensuring the event remains tasteful and free from unnecessary pomp and show.

The Kitni Mohabbat Hai fame actress confirmed her relationship with Gaurav Kapoor in December 2025 through a subtle yet adorable Instagram post. Sharing a series of pictures together, she captioned it simply, “Breakfast with,” while the text on the images read, “Does it have to be so cheesy?” The post quickly went viral, sparking excitement among fans who had long speculated about her love life. The couple was also recently spotted in Mumbai, stepping out of a luxury car and posing for paparazzi, further fueling wedding buzz.

Born in Bareilly, Uttar Pradesh, Kritika Kamra is 37 years old and comes from a Punjabi Hindu family. Her father was a doctor, and her mother served as a school principal in Sukhpur near Ashoknagar, Madhya Pradesh. She studied at Delhi Public School, Vasant Kunj, before enrolling at the National Institute of Fashion Technology (NIFT), Delhi, where she pursued fashion communication. Interestingly, her acting journey began after she met a casting director outside her college campus.

Kritika rose to fame with Kitni Mohabbat Hai and later starred in popular shows like Kuch Toh Log Kahenge and Reporters. She made her big-screen debut with Bheed, directed by Anubhav Sinha. On OTT, she impressed audiences with performances in Tandav, Bombay Meri Jaan, and Saare Jahan Se Achha. She was recently appreciated for her role in the OTT film The Great Shamsuddin Family.
